What will I learn from this course The protection engineer will gain an in-depth understanding of the
major protective element algorithms for the D30 and D60 Relays. The
review of a sample settings file in addition to Oscillography and Event
Logs for specific faults will aid in a complete understanding of how to
apply the D30 or D60 and how the relays should perform.
Who should attend? This course is designed for protection engineering staff responsible for
Transmission Line protective relay selection and settings.
Prerequisites
UR Platform course
A Degree in Electrical Engineering or completion of the Fundamentals of Modern Protective Relaying course
UR Data Communications course an asset
The Transmission Line Protection Interactive Learning CD would be an asset
